Connection mode of electric vehicle charging cable

Publish Date 2022-08-08
There are the following 4 charging connection modes for electric vehicle charging cables:

Charging mode 1: It is a combination of single-head charging gun + cable + ordinary CEE plug connected to single-phase mains

Charging mode 2: It is a combination of single-head charging gun + cable + control box + plug connected to single-phase mains

Charging mode 3: a combination of single-head charging gun + cable + control box + plug connected to single-phase mains

Charging mode 4: a combination of charging gun + cable + charging pile connected to direct current (DC)


The difference is: the difference between charging mode 2 and charging mode 1 is to increase the number of controllers. Compared with charging mode 1, charging mode 2 has complete protection measures, including over-voltage, under-voltage, over-current, over-temperature, leakage and power-off protection. There are no protective measures. Three-phase charging mode For the first two modes, mode three increases the charging current to increase the charging speed, and the demand for charging safety will also be higher. The fourth charging mode is a DC charging gun.

Of course, there are three connection methods:
The charging cable is connected to the electric vehicle end, and is pluggable to the power grid connection end;
The charging cable is connected to the power grid connection end, and is pluggable when connected to the electric vehicle end;
The charging cable is pluggable to both the electric vehicle end and the grid connection end.
